LOUISA, Ky. — A Floyd County couple is in jail, after allegedly stealing a car from a Lawrence County gas station, then leading police on a chase.

Police were called to the Louisa Zip Zone just before 1:30 Monday morning over a report that a 2018 Dodge Journey had been stolen from the parking lot. An officer caught up with the vehicle on Route 1760 and attempted to pull it over, but it sped away instead.

During the ensuing chase, the car forced another car to crash, resulting in minor injuries to the other driver.

The driver — later identified as Stephanie Hamilton, 42, of Hi Hat — and passenger — Jason Hamilton, 44, of Teaberry — then abandoned the car in the middle of the road and fled on foot. They were later found hiding in a nearby barn and arrested.

Stephanie Hamilton told police she saw the owner get out and leave the vehicle running, so she took it. She was charged with auto theft, fleeing police and reckless driving.

Jason Hamilton told police he didn’t know the car was stolen until after he got inside. He was charged with complicity to the auto theft and fleeing charges.
Both are being held in the Big Sandy Regional Detention Center, in Paintsville.
